Speaking as a Striker Titan main, I LOVE shoulder charge. ;) This is my favorite move in PvP and I also use it frequently in lower level PvE situations. I completely understand where you're coming from, though. Shoulder Charge is a cheap move in PvP. It does take skill to use effectively, and it does have its weaknesses, but it provides easy kills a lot of the time. That being said, each class has at least one cheap mechanic that can be complained about. As you pointed out earlier, warlocks have access to an over-shield melee attack they can use. Hunters have shade-step and essentially two grenades (if you count smoke). With each class in "Destiny" having at least one cheap mechanic available to them in PvP, it balances things out, it's a balance of cheapness. What matters most is: 1) Finding which class is your fave in crucible. 2) Mastering your move-set, including the cheap ones. 3) Become fully aware of the move-set of your opponents and the situations in which they're most likely to use them. 4) Think of ways to either counter those cheap moves OR put yourself in a situation where their use of a cheap move is risky. I'll give you an example against my Striker Titan. 1) This is my fave class in Crucible because I love shoulder charge, I love regaining health with my melees, and I love getting up close & personal; this is my ideal subclass. 2) Done. Ideally I try to kill with shoulder charge, charged melees to regain health, and a shotgun. Pros: Close in, I'm deadly. Con: Mid-to-far range, I'm dead. 3) Hunters and Warlocks have access to moves, either through evasion (shade-step) or defense (over-shield melee) to negate my shoulder charge. It is also advantageous to me if my enemy fires upon me with anything other than a shotgun. If they use a shotgun they can instantly shut me down, while I can usually close distance against any other gun before it kills me. 4) Counters: Hunters can shade-step out of the way. Warlocks can over-shield melee as I'm rushing them (which has worked against me before). Both require some good timing but are possible. Shotguns are also HIGHLY effective at shutting down rushing Titans; they are the #1 weapon I die to in crucible while rushing. Strategies: On small maps, or maps with tight corridors like Anomaly, I own. On large maps, like First Light, I'm weak. I can also easily be countered on small or tight maps with a shotgun. Every class, and even subclass, can be broken down thusly. I understand if you only like playing in crucible a particular way, and you want that one way to translate well against all opponents in all situations, and if you're good enough maybe you can make that happen, but try to differentiate your strategies based upon the makeup of your opponents and you may find yourself having more success and fun.
